Five corruption cases pertaining to DoNER in 2007-09: Govt

New Delhi: The Central Vigilance Commission has found five cases of alleged corruption pertaining to Ministry of Development of North Eastern Region (DoNER) during 2007-09, the Government informed Rajya Sabha today.

"As per information received from the CVC, they have dealt with a total of five cases of alleged corruption pertaining to the Ministry of DoNeR during 2007-09," DoNeR Minister B K Handique said in replying to a question.

He said no exclusive wing has been established in the CVC for the North Eastern region.

Handique said his Ministry has laid down a huge emphasis on monitoring and evaluation of its schemes and programmes.
